Luke Rawson (born 25 March 2001) is an English footballer who plays as a forward for Northern Premier League Division One East club Stocksbridge Park Steels.
Rawson played for Chesterfield's youth team, hitting headlines when he scored for the team's reserves as a 16-year-old in 2017. [2] He made his senior debut for the 'Spireites' in their final EFL League Two game of the 2017–18 season while still a first-year scholar, coming off the bench as an 82nd minute substitute for captain Drew Talbot. [3]
In September 2018, Rawson joined Matlock Town on a one-month loan deal. [4] He joined Sheffield on loan in December, [5] before returning to Chesterfield to make two appearances. [6] He rejoined Sheffield on loan in January 2019. [7]
In August 2019, Rawson once again joined Matlock town on a one-month loan deal. [8]
On 14 October 2019, Rawson joined Brighouse Town on loan until January 2020. [9] On 31 January 2020, he was then loaned out to Handsworth until 28 April 2020. [10]
On 12 December 2020, Rawson joined National League North side Alfreton Town on loan for a month. [11] On 19 January, Rawson joined fellow National League North side Bradford (Park Avenue) on a five-week loan deal. [12]
On 2 August 2021, Rawson returned to National League North side Bradford (Park Avenue), this time on a permanent deal following his release from Chesterfield. [13] On 28 January 2022, he was sent out again to Sheffield, dropping down two divisions to play in the Northern Premier League Division One East for a month-long loan. [14] In February, this loan was extended until the end of the season. [15]
In July 2022, Rawson signed for Stocksbridge Park Steels. [16]
